Briggs OHV & Vanguard / Vanguard Question.
« on: May 05, 2009, 08:22:00 am »
Ok heres the problem....

 I am having trouble with this thing cutting off coming out of the corners.

 Sometimes I think its because of bumpy tracks, this seems to be when it does it the most.

But on the same token I have had it do it on a pretty smooth track as well. Most of the time on a smooth track it looses the throttle response off the corner. (Kinda like a quadrabog).

The carb hasn't been "worked" but has the jets bored and is and has been super cleaned.

Now heres the the thing I can run sometimes 4 or 5 laps before it does it, then when it does cut off, I can start it right back up and take off.
And it seems to always do it in the same corner once it cuts off and will do it everytime. In other words I can restart and run all the way around the track until I get to the same corner again and it will die again.

 It acts like its starving for fuel because if I hold the throttle open it won't start. If I don't touch the throttle until it fires it will start pretty fast.

I have talked to Mr Herrin and he suggested coils might be going bad. I have a set of coils and I will replace them. ;)

 I just want to see what kinda of suggestions you guys have.
I have been fighting this problem off and on now for over a year! About tired of it. :bash:

Has anybody else ran into this problem? :confused:
